Ranji Trophy 2025-26: Former Delhi all-rounder Lalit Yadav smashes double hundred in first appearance for Goa
Former Delhi all-rounder Lalit Yadav scored a double-century in his maiden First-Class appearance for Goa, against Chandigarh, during the opening round of the Ranji Trophy 2025-26 season on Thursday.
The 28-year-old reached his double ton off 373 balls, with the help of 20 fours and four sixes, after coming in to bat at No. 5. Lalit’s knock was part of a strong batting performance from Goa, with debutant Abhinav Tejrana also smashing a double hundred earlier on the second day’s play.
Lalit and Tejrana put on a mammoth 309-run partnership off 510 deliveries for the fourth wicket, before the latter was dismissed for 205 runs off 320 balls.
This is Lalit’s first First-Class game since January, 2023, when his former team Delhi faced off against Hyderabad. The all-rounder endured a tough 2022-23 season, averaging 15.71 in four matches and picking only three wickets as Delhi finished a disappointing sixth in the Elite Group B standings.
